About the Organisation

Established in 1951, the International Organization for Migration (IOM) is a Related Organization of the United Nations, and as the leading UN agency in the field of migration, works closely with governmental, intergovernmental and non-governmental partners. IOM is dedicated to promoting humane and orderly migration for the benefit of all. It does so by providing services and advice to governments and migrants.  IOM is committed to a diverse and inclusive environment.

Job Title:  VN_UG_001_2025 Senior Finance Associate (G6) (UN Jobs)

Organisation: International Organization for Migration (IOM)

Duty Station:  Kampala, Uganda


Under the overall supervision of the Resource Management Officer and direct supervision of the National Finance Officer and, in collaboration with relevant units at Headquarters and the Administrative Centres, the successful candidate will be responsible and accountable for managing the resources management functions in Kampala, Uganda.

  • Provide procedural guidance to managers and staff; supervise, guide and train other finance support staff.

  • Assist in the preparation of budget, accounting, financial, statistical reports, and other reports as required.

  • Manage financial resources through monitoring and controlling assets, reserves, funds, supplies, etc. in accordance with IOM rules and regulations.

  • Provide specialized advice and support to RMO and Project Managers on financial and administrative matters and ensuring activities are implemented in a manner consistent with Donor agreements.

  • Provide specialized support preparing annual budget submission and revisions including estimating the cost of staff as well as rental and utilities, office equipment and supplies, and other contracts, services or running expenses.

  • Assist in monitoring compliance with financial policies, procedures, rules, and regulations and bring to the attention of the RMO any issues.

  • Consolidate data into financial statements and assist in monitoring expenditures to ensure they remain within authorized levels.

  • Provide regular and ad hoc financial information to support informed financial decision making.

  • Assist monitoring that bank reconciliations for IOM accounts are regularly performed and reviewed by designated stakeholders.

  • Review monthly accounting reports prior to submission to MAC

  • Manage and prepare the payroll by executing validity checks on monthly payroll results and ensure salaries are properly allocated to projects.

  • Ensure that disbursements are made based on proper authorizations and supported by legitimate and sufficient documentation.

  • Aid responding to audit queries and follow up on audit recommendations.

  • Review the status and monitor the proper maintenance of Vendor Accounts in accounting system.

  • Verify vendor claims for accuracy and conformance with IOM finance policies and instructions.

  • Perform other related duties as required.

Qualifications, Education and Competencies

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Accounting, Finances, or related field from an accredited academic institution with four years of relevant professional experience OR ;

  • High School diploma with six years of relevant experience;

  • Completion of a Professional Certificate in ACCA/CPA.

  • Accredited Universities are those listed in the UNESCO World Higher Education Database.


Experience

  • Prior work experience with international humanitarian organizations, non-government or government institutions/organization in a multi-cultural setting is an advantage.

  • Knowledge of International Public Sector Accounting Standards (IPSAS) and SAP is highly desirable

  • Audit experience is highly regarded

  • Familiarize with financial oversight and public administration


Skills

  • Proficient in Microsoft Office applications e.g. Word, Excel, PowerPoint, E-mail, Outlook; previous experience in SAP is a distinct advantage;

  • Attention to detail, ability to organize paperwork in a methodical way;

  • Discreet, details and clients-oriented, patient and willingness to learn new things;


Languages

  • For this position, fluency in English is required (oral and written)

  • Fluent in Kiswahili

  • IOM’s official languages are English, French and Spanish.

  • Proficiency of language(s) required will be specifically evaluated during the selection process, which may include written and/or oral assessments.
